Calibrated colour–magnitude diagrams for Sh2-152 a) and the control field b). The black lines represent isochrones of solar metallicity and 11.2 Gyr, located at three distances (3.0, 4.0 and 5.0 kpc) and the grey curve, the position of a K2 III star at several distances. The isochrone was generated using the Pietrinferni et al. (2004) stellar evolutionary library, the Castelli & Kurucz (2003) bolometric correction library and the Rieke et al. (1989) extinction law with R = 3.09 (Rieke & Lebofsky 1985). For the K2 III sequence, MV was obtained from Cox (2000) and IR intrinsic colours from Ducati et al. (2001).
